Judgment text excerpt

The Supreme Court, in a suit under Article 131 of the Constitution, addressed the territorial dispute between the State of Orissa and the State of Andhra Pradesh regarding the Borra Group of villages. The Court held that the disputed area, although geographically located within Andhra Pradesh, was historically part of the Jeypore Estate and thus belonged to Orissa as per the Orissa Order, 1936. The Court declared that Andhra Pradesh's administration over the area constituted trespass and ordered it to vacate the disputed territory.
